Beschreibung:

A VICTORIAN MAHOGANY MONTH GOING WALL REGULATOR
E. J. DENT, LONDON, NO. 673. CIRCA 1845
A VICTORIAN MAHOGANY MONTH GOING WALL REGULATOR E. J. DENT, LONDON, NO. 673. CIRCA 1845 CASE: with fully glazed detachable front section, the backboard with a pair of finely engraved and silvered height and beat scales; case key DIAL: the 10¾ in. diameter engraved and silvered dial of regulator format signed 'E. J. DENT LONDON/Clock Maker to the Queen/673', blued steel hands MOVEMENT: mounted on brackets numbered '673', the substantial plates joined by four rear-screwed pillars, Harrison's maintaining power and high count train, the dead beat escapement mounted on the back plate and having jewelled pallets and club-toothed 'scape wheel, the two-piece crutch with fine beat adjustment, repeat signature to the back plate; steel jar mercury pendulum (mercury removed), fine regulating weights, brass weight, crank winding key 65 in. (165 cm.) high; 11¼ in. (28.5 cm.) wide; 8½ in. (21.5 cm.) deep
